Just how does humor in fact function? For centuries, scholars as well as terrific thinkers tried to clear up the quandary that is humor. Thinkers and also wit academics largely subscribed to 3 institutions of believed when clarifying why we find enjoyment in life: the supremacy concept, alleviation theory, and difference theory.

It presumes that things are funny when we feel exceptional to others or to prior, lowly variations of ourselves. Think: buffooning humor or self-deprecating humor.

Theorists as well as wit academics greatly subscribed to 3 institutions of assumed when discussing why we find amusement in life: the prevalence concept, alleviation theory, and difference concept.

It assumes that things are amusing when we really feel above others or to prior, lowly variations of ourselves. Think: mocking wit or self-deprecating humor. Sigmund Freud's interpretation, referred to as the alleviation concept, is that the act of giggling releases pent-up worried power or stress, such as when poking fun at taboo or sex-related subjects.
